What should the tripping point be on a lead acid battery?

When the Tripping point is set to 14.5V, the battery will charge for about 75% of its capacity. If you want to charge 100%, then set the tripping point to ≈16V by removing the 7815 regulator and directly supplying 18V DC, but this is not recommended.

How is the peak short circuit of a battery determined?

399-1997 states that the peak short-circuit current that a battery can deliver is limited by its internal resistance, including the intercell connectors. The greater the battery’s resistance, the lower the peak short-circuit value. The rise time is dependent on the ratio of the battery’s inductance to its reactance.
